Ascent Capital Group, Inc. provides home security alarm monitoring services. It operates through the following business segments: Moni and LiveWatch. The Moni segment provides security alarm monitoring services: monitoring signals arising from burglaries, fires, medical alerts, and other events through security systems. The LiveWatch segment is a do-it-yourself home security provider, which offers monitored security services through a direct-to-consumer sales channel. Ascent Capital Group was founded on May 29, 2008 and is headquartered Greenwood Village, CO.
